Text
(a)A specialty contractor is a contractor whose operations involve the performance of construction work requiring special skill and whose principal contracting business involves the use of specialized building trades or crafts.
(b)A specialty contractor includes a contractor whose operations include the business of servicing or testing fire extinguishing systems.
(c)A specialty contractor includes a contractor whose operations are concerned with the installation and laying of carpets, linoleum, and resilient floor covering.
